How to represent a visual specification
Visual language theory
Concepts and realization of a diagram editor generator based on hypergraph transformation
Science of Computer Programming - Special issue on applications of graph transformations (GRATRA 2000)
Generating Diagram Editors with DiaGen
AGTIVE '99 Proceedings of the International Workshop on Applications of Graph Transformations with Industrial Relevance
Creating Semantic Representations of Diagrams
AGTIVE '99 Proceedings of the International Workshop on Applications of Graph Transformations with Industrial Relevance
CC '98 Proceedings of the 7th International Conference on Compiler Construction
DiaGen: a generator for diagram editors providing direct manipulation and execution of diagrams
VL '95 Proceedings of the 11th International IEEE Symposium on Visual Languages
Visual programming with graph rewriting systems
VL '95 Proceedings of the 11th International IEEE Symposium on Visual Languages
A graph based framework for the implementation of visual environments
VL '96 Proceedings of the 1996 IEEE Symposium on Visual Languages
Diagram Editing with Hypergraph Parser Support
VL '97 Proceedings of the 1997 IEEE Symposium on Visual Languages (VL '97)
Constraint-Based Diagram Beautification
VL '99 Proceedings of the IEEE Symposium on Visual Languages
GXL: Toward a Standard Exchange Format
WCRE '00 Proceedings of the Seventh Working Conference on Reverse Engineering (WCRE'00)
Increasing XML interoperability in Visual Rewriting Systems
WebMedia '05 Proceedings of the 11th Brazilian Symposium on Multimedia and the web
Hi-index | 0.00 |
When diagram editors are used as components of larger software systems they are not only used as an input facility for diagrams, but also for visualizing results or other data structures which are externally represented. Examples are UML tools which are used for re-engineering. This paper presents a generic unparsing approach which allows for creating diagrams from XML-coded external data structures. This approach has been integrated into the diagram editor generator DiaGen. It is based on an XSLT specification of the rule-based unparsing process which creates a hypergraph model of the resulting diagram.